У меня есть установка, где у меня есть человечность как прокси-сервер сквида в моем доме. Все компьютеры и iPad при моем домашнем использовании та человечность как прокси-сервер. Теперь я хочу, чтобы сквид перенаправил весь запрос к ec2 экземпляру для просмотра. Например, если я просматриваю сайт www.example.com от моего домашнего компьютера, он переходит к прокси сквида в той же сети, теперь вместо того, чтобы непосредственно служить страницам из Интернета, я хочу, чтобы прокси сквида заставил ssh туннелировать к ec2 экземпляру и получить страницы от www.example.com до ec2 экземпляра. Экземпляр EC2 является человечностью снова.
Я выяснил, как настроить suqid для угождения моим домашним компьютерам, но не уверенный, как я должен установить сквид для туннелирования к ec2 для угождения Интернету вместо непосредственно Интернета движения. Любые указатели здесь будут полезны.
Присоединенный изображение моей домашней установки.
Могли Вы разъясняться, хотите ли Вы использовать свой экземпляр EC2 в качестве дополнительного шлюза, так например, что-то вроде этого:
client -> somepage.domain1.com -> lan squid -> lan internet
client -> somepage.domain2.com -> lan squid -> ec2 -> internet
Это то, что Вы имеете в виду? Если так, я сначала предостерег бы, что Вы будете обвинены за сетевой трафик для чего-либо, оставляя Ваш экземпляр EC2 - и это могло стать дорогостоящим.
Я думаю, чем Вы могли бы интересоваться, настраивает сквид cache_peer. Смотрите на этот документ о предмете